Earth Day and Earthsave Canada

April 22 is Earth Day. What better way to become more informed on the topic of planetary mindfulness than to talk about Earthsave Canada—our very own Vancouver-based registered charity! Earthsave International was originally created in the United States in 1988, and was founded by John Robbins, son of one half of the Baskin-Robbins ice cream empire. When it became … Read more

Help make Catfé happen in Vancouver!

What is Catfé? Catfé is one part cafe, one part foster home for cats, and all parts community gathering space for cat lovers in Vancouver in need of some quality kitty time. We’ll have a colony of adoptable cats living onsite, and will offer drinks and snacks, wifi access, a library of books and boardgames … Read more
